2027 BMW i5 xDrive40 Sedan (21 inch Wheels): home charging cost in Utah

A 2027 BMW i5 xDrive40 Sedan (21 inch Wheels) draws 36.5 kWh per 100 miles per the EPA; at Utah's 13.17¢/kWh residential rate that's $4.81 per 100 miles charged at home, versus $16.02 for a 25.5-mpg gas car covering the same distance. Charging at home costs a fraction of what gas would here: 70% less than gas per mile, here specifically.

Annual cost, at 15 thousands miles a year

Driving 15,000 miles a year — fueleconomy.gov's own default assumption — a 2027 BMW i5 xDrive40 Sedan (21 inch Wheels) charged at home in Utah costs about $721/year in electricity, against about $2,403/year for the gas-car comparison. That's a savings of about $1,682 a year.

Filling up the 2027 BMW i5 xDrive40 Sedan (21 inch Wheels), in dollars

A 2027 BMW i5 xDrive40 Sedan (21 inch Wheels) needs roughly 95.6 kWh to reach its EPA-rated 262-mile range, which runs about $12.59 at 13.17¢/kWh in Utah.
